Rockwell Place is moderately more affordable than Appleby, with a 11.3% lower cost of living index. Appleby scores 77 compared to 69 for Rockwell Place,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Appleby can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.

On the housing front, median rent in Appleby is $938/month compared to $962/month in Rockwell Place — a 3%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while Appleby has cheaper rent, Rockwell Place actually has lower median home values ($97,600 vs $212,000).

Median household income in Appleby is $79,844 compared to $57,396 in Rockwell Place (+39.1%). While Appleby is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Appleby spend roughly 14.1% of their income on rent, less than the 20.1% in Rockwell Place.
